RESTRAINT
"Stringent Environmental Regulations and Emission Standards"
The chemical synthesis process traditionally generates significant quantities of greenhouse gases which present substantial operational challenges for the Adipic Acid Market participants. Nitrous oxide emissions require sophisticated abatement technologies to comply with evolving environmental protection mandates across major manufacturing regions. Implementing these emission control systems can increase initial facility capital expenditure by up to 25% for new installations. Existing plants face complex retrofitting requirements that often necessitate facility downtime extending up to 18 months for complete integration. This Adipic Acid Market Analysis demonstrates how regulatory compliance pressures impact overall production economics and influence capacity expansion decisions. The technical complexity associated with achieving a 95% reduction in harmful emissions creates a high barrier to entry for prospective manufacturers seeking to establish new production capabilities within highly regulated geographic territories.

Polyurethanes: The Polyurethanes segment occupies a crucial position within the Adipic Acid Market utilizing the chemical to produce specialized polyester polyols for diverse industrial applications. This application sector leverages the unique chemical properties of the acid to manufacture high performance elastomers coatings and synthetic leathers. Industry figures demonstrate that this specific application category accounts for approximately 20% of global chemical consumption highlighting its importance to overall market stability. The resulting polyurethane materials exhibit exceptional flexibility and abrasion resistance making them highly sought after in the footwear and furniture manufacturing industries. Adipate Esters: The Adipate Esters segment serves as a specialized but highly valuable application category within the Adipic Acid Market ecosystem. These chemical compounds function primarily as high performance plasticizers and synthetic lubricants across various industrial domains. The formulation of these esters requires highly purified precursor materials to ensure the final products meet stringent regulatory requirements for food contact and medical applications. Market data reveals that the demand for these specialized plasticizers maintains a consistent 12% adoption rate particularly in the production of flexible polyvinyl chloride materials. These esters impart exceptional low temperature flexibility to polymer products making them essential for specialized wire and cable insulation operating in extreme environments. Others: The Others segment encompasses a diverse array of specialized applications that contribute incrementally to the overall Adipic Acid Market expansion. This broad category includes the production of specialized adhesives food additives and pharmaceutical intermediates requiring highly specific chemical grades. Food industry applications utilize the acid as a flavorant and gelling aid demanding precursors with absolute purity profiles to meet health and safety regulations. Industrial statistics indicate these niche applications collectively absorb approximately 5% of global production capacity providing essential diversification for chemical manufacturers. The pharmaceutical sector utilizes these compounds as critical intermediates for synthesizing active pharmaceutical ingredients requiring meticulous quality control protocols.
